After 430 glorious chapters,My Hero Academiafinished its ten-year run in August 2024, but according to its most recent social media update, Kōhei Horikoshi still has treats in store. According toMy Hero Academia’sX(formerly Twitter) account, the manga will get a 38-page epilogue detailing the events beyond the final chapter. After the stunning developments following Deku’s final battle against Shigaraki, the manga still has stories to tell, despite the final chapter being a time-skip epilogue in and of itself.

My Hero Academia’simmaculately detailed manga art and tonally more cheerful animeset itself apart from otherwise darker contemporary battle shōnen series.With over 100 million copies in circulation, the manga’s popularity is undeniable. The series easily cruised over from the Japanese market to an eager global pool of consumers eager for superhero and shōnen manga fiction. But with one final manga volume releasing on June 02, 2025, in Japan, the series is setting up one last hurrah asMy Hero Academiabows out for good.

Eagle-Eyed My Hero Academia Fans Spotted the Extra Pages a Month Ago

Never Underestimate the Investigative Power of Otaku

At the end of October,My Hero Academiafans quickly spotted and posted toRedditabout a Japanese listing for volume #42, indicating 184 pages, easily meaning more content than usual. While some were quick to dismiss it as an extra-large sampling of sketches already posted to Twitter,others were optimistic, talking about how that would still not account for dozens of added pages. With fan theories including speculation about the pages featuring post-time-skip designs for Deku and friends, there’s plenty of excitement about what the extra content could entail.

While it’s likely not all built up to entail an extra epilogue,My Hero Academiaarguably already had a satisfying ending. However, with people wishing for a longer epilogue with the final chapter, this could be a chance to see what Class 1A has been up to in the eight years since the main story’s conclusion. WithMy Hero Academiavolume #42’s release in December, the internet will surely erupt with new opinions on the series' updated finale.

My Hero Academia is a multimedia franchise that follows a young boy named Izuku Midoriya, who dreams of becoming a hero despite being born without superpowers. These superpowers, known as “Quirks” are found in most people after birth, but Izuku wasn’t so lucky - until a fateful encounter with All Might, Japan’s greatest hero, Izuku inherits his Quirk and enrolls in U.A. High School to learn the true meaning of heroism. Alongside his classmates, each endowed with unique abilities, Izuku faces rigorous training and lethal threats from villainous forces.
